Está en la página 1de 2

El principal objetivo del pseudocódigo es el de representar la solución a un algoritmo

de la forma más detallada posible, y a su vez lo más parecida posible al lenguaje que
posteriormente se utilizara para la codificación del mismo. 

un pseudocódigo es una serie de palabras que se utilizan para diseñar un algoritmo


sin caer en una redacción ni tampoco en el otro extremo de la codificación del
algoritmo en un lenguaje especifico y con una sintaxis mas dura. Es como un
"lenguaje genérico", te sirve para luego de entender el problema puedas diseñar un
algoritmo que lo solucione, de esta manera se puede desarrollar una solución de una
manera un poco mas rápida que utilizando directamente un lenguaje.  

El Pseudocódigo se usa como bosquejo o borrador cuando se hace un programa...


Cuando se ha hecho el diagrama de flujo, se hace en pseudocódigo para ir revisando
las diferentes opciones que ofrece el compilador. Finalmente se escribe el programa
formalmente.  

DFD

Un diagrama de flujo de datos (DFD) traza el flujo de la información


para cualquier proceso o sistema. Emplea símbolos definidos, como
rectángulos, círculos y flechas, además de etiquetas de texto breves,
para mostrar las entradas y salidas de datos, los puntos de
almacenamiento y las rutas entre cada destino.
Se pueden usar para analizar un sistema existente o para modelar
uno nuevo. De forma similar a todos los mejores diagramas y
gráficos, un DFD puede con frecuencia "decir" visualmente cosas que
serían difíciles de explicar en palabras y funcionan para audiencias
tanto técnicas como no técnicas, desde desarrolladores hasta
directores. 
Tipos de diagramas de flujo:

 Formato vertical: El flujo o la secuencia de las operaciones, va de arriba hacia abajo. Es


una lista ordenada de las operaciones de un proceso con toda la información que se
considere necesaria, según su propósito.

                                  
 Formato horizontal: El flujo o la secuencia de las operaciones, va de izquierda a derecha.

 Formato panorámico: El proceso entero está representado en un solo diagrama, tanto en


sentido vertical como horizontal, permitiendo distintas acciones simultáneas.

 Formato arquitectónico: Describe el itinerario de ruta de una forma o


persona sobre el plano arquitectónico del área de trabajo.
 Diagrama de bloques de modelo matemático: Es el utilizado para
representar sistemas físicos (reales). Cada uno de los bloques que
componen el sistema físico es generalmente una simplificación de la
realidad, lo que permite un tratamiento matemático razonable.
 Diagrama de bloques de procesos de producción:  Es un diagrama
utilizado para indicar la manera en la que se elabora cierto producto,
especificando la materia prima, la cantidad de procesos y la forma en la que
se presenta el producto terminado.

 Los diagramas de flujo favorecen la comprensión del proceso a través de un dibujo además
permiten identificar los problemas y las oportunidades de mejora del proceso. Pero tiene algunas
desventajas como que ocupa demasiado espacio, ilustran el flujo del programa, pero no su
estructura.

El pseudocódigo por su parte es más fácil de modificar, se puede ejecutar en un ordenador aunque
tiene desventajas como un complejo de entender para la persona común y corriente y no es tan
sencillo para los programadores principiantes.

También podría gustarte